The Garden of the Island is one of the most emblematic historical and natural spaces of Aranjuez. Located next to the Royal Palace of Aranjuez, it is part of the set of historic gardens that contributed to the Cultural Landscape of Aranjuez being declared World Heritage by UNESCO.

Its origin dates back to the reign of Philip II, who promoted the creation of the Aranjuez gardens. The layout of the Garden of the Island is related to the architect Juan Bautista de Toledo, and later the space was enriched during the reigns of the Austrians and the Bourbons.

🌿 A historic garden next to the Royal Palace

The Island Garden is notable for its tree-lined walkways, hedges, centuries-old trees, and numerous monumental fountains. National Heritage indicates that the garden covers approximately 23 hectares, boasting significant botanical diversity and historical features that allow visitors to enjoy both nature and the artistic heritage of Aranjuez.

Among its most outstanding features are several monumental fountains, including those dedicated to Apollo, Hercules, Venus, Bacchus, Neptune, and Diana. The presence of water and fountains is one of the defining characteristics of the Royal Site's historic gardens.

🚗 Parking near the Island Garden

Aranjuez Palace Parking — Calle Valeras 2D

If you are visiting the Island Garden and the Royal Palace of Aranjuez by car, you can use the Aranjuez Palace Parking, located at Calle Valeras 2D.

The Aranjuez City Council indicates that the parking garage on Calle Valeras is located near the Palace and that the renovated facility has 360 spaces, improving aspects such as security, accessibility, and functionality.
